编译器在Web开发中的应用可以帮助优化Web应用的响应速度。以下是一些步骤和技术可以帮助提高Web应用的性能和响应速度:
1、缩短导航时间:导航是加载web页面的第一步。Web性能优化的目标之一就是缩短导航完成所花费的时间。这可以通过使用缓存、最小化重定向、减少DNS查询等技术来实现。
2、优化代码:代码优化可以通过减少HTTP请求、压缩代码、使用CDN、避免阻塞渲染进程等技术来实现。
3、使用Web框架:使用Web框架可以帮助避免重新发明轮子,从而缩短开发时间和提高Web应用的性能。例如,使用Express框架可以快速创建Web应用,处理HTTP动词、路由、静态文件等。
4、使用渐进式Web应用(PWA):PWA使用开放Web技术提供跨平台互操作性,类似于支持平台上的本机应用,为用户提供针对其设备自定义的应用式体验。PWA结合了Web和编译应用的最佳功能,为用户提供类似原生应用的用户体验。

5、在线编译环境:在线编译环境可以帮助提供一种即上网即使用的编译环境,将用户提交的程序在服务器端编译并运行,将运行结果返回客户端,从而提高Web应用的性能和响应速度。
除了上述步骤和技术外,以下是一些其他可用于优化Web应用的技术和工具:
1、使用Web Workers:Web Workers是一种在后台运行的JavaScript线程,可以让Web应用在执行计算密集型任务时不会阻塞UI线程,从而提高Web应用的性能。
2、使用HTTP/2:HTTP/2是一种新的HTTP协议,可以提供更快的页面加载速度和更高的性能。HTTP/2支持多路复用、头部压缩、服务器推送等特性,可以减少页面加载时间和提高Web应用的性能。
3、使用工具进行性能测试:使用工具进行性能测试可以帮助发现Web应用中的瓶颈和问题,从而优化Web应用的性能和响应速度。例如,Google提供了PageSpeed Insights工具,可以帮助分析Web应用的性能,并提供优化建议。
总之,编译器在Web开发中的应用可以帮助优化Web应用的响应速度。通过采用上述步骤和技术,可以提高Web应用的性能和响应速度,从而提供更好的用户体验。